Leonardo DiCaprio buys $5.2 mn house

Actor Leonardo DiCaprio has purchased the former estate of singer/actress Dinah Shore in the Old Las Palmas neighbourhood of Palm Springs for $5.2 million.

The 39-year-old bought the Donald Wexler-designed home that is spread over 1.3 acres and features six bedrooms, a pool, tennis court and detached gym, reports hollywoodreporter.com.

The sellers, Ben Lipps and wife Jude, bought the estate for $4.9 million in April 2011. The home was offered for $5.5 million Jan 16 and was promptly purchased by the actor for $5.2 million.

"This is the quintessential mid-century modern home," said a local architecture expert.
